// Welcome aboard! This client talks to Slabline, our partition manager.
// Tables in the Orchardfall warehouse are partitioned by month, and Slabline
// handles creating next month's partition ahead of time plus dropping
// anything past the 18-month retention window. Don't create partitions by
// hand — Slabline's naming scheme is picky and mismatches break the sweeper.
// The client below connects to the internal Slabline API and authenticates
// with the key on the following line.

API key for yahig-tadup: kto7_ubizbYm

Step 7: Migrate the order-cutoff rule for Ovenhart's bakery ordering service. The cutoff logic previously lived in client code; it now runs server-side in the Crumbline scheduler, which rejects orders submitted after the daily cutoff and queues them for the next bake cycle. Verify that the cutoff evaluation uses the server clock in the bakery's local timezone, since client-supplied timestamps are no longer trusted. No customer data is involved in this step. The scheduler reads the following configuration values at startup.

config for fahog-hahip:
ZORWYN_HOST=zorwyn.lumicsys.internal
ZORWYN_PORT=9200

UserSplit Cutover Drift: the extracted account service and the legacy Marigold monolith user module are reporting divergent record counts during dual-write. This fires when drift exceeds 0.5% over 15 minutes. New team members should not replay writes manually. Reconciliation steps and the rollback procedure are documented on the internal page.

wiki page, tajog-fafog: https://gitlab.paliqsys.corp/dash/display/job/853dd6fcbf54